I have a 07 f 150 2wd screw, and i'm about to put a 2.5" level and a 3" body lift. I was wondering if i could fit a 315/70/17 xtreme m/t pro camp on it without any problems, if i can which wheels would i have to buy? and anyone have a cheap source for getting wheels?

Yes, they will fit easily. I'd go with a 9 inch wide wheel with 5 inches of backspacing.
